Output 87516723e07b1f9a86d637e1ad22a4ea02898381077eb8e37c47c54c7c093f59:4

value
305330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c7ce9f112c7366475e5010276275de344fc569 OP_EQUAL
address
3EcgZS6j2dfaTXwds2yBhjsMVb13jgohfH
transaction
87516723e07b1f9a86d637e1ad22a4ea02898381077eb8e37c47c54c7c093f59
spent
true